Inktomi - Raq4 problem
Thanks for your reply David but you missed the point ( due to poor wording
on my part - im newish to this, but trying ), this is not a standard
redirection. We have one raq4 with multiple websites, (name based virtual
domains - single IP)
Let me see if i can explain this more clearly, *scratches head*
I tellnet into site A on port 80.
- open www.siteA.com 80
I attempt a get for a page known to be part of site A
- get /PageA/
The server responds with a 302 and says [FOUND]
---but---
The document has moved here
-www.siteB.com/PageA
This url does not work if entered into a browser and simply does not exist
If anyone has had this kind of problem on a raq 4 and can tell me a way
around this without having to learn the dark arts of 'mod_rewrite' for
something that i *assume* is a problem with the virtual domains they can
email me and I can show you exactly what I mean.
